Latin America's 50 Best Restaurants is the Latin American offshoot of The World's 50 Best Restaurants ranking, launched in 2013. The voter panel is composed of around 200 Latin American and Caribbean experts. The ceremony is held annually in a major Latin American city. The ranking reflects the rise of Peruvian cuisine (Central, Maido, Astrid y Gaston), Mexican (Pujol, Quintonil, Sud777), Brazilian (DOM, Mocoto, Oteque), Argentinian (Don Julio, Tegui) and Chilean (Borago). Latin America's 50 Best 2026 crowned Central Lima (Virgilio Martinez) at the top for the fourth consecutive year. The ranking accompanies the 2026 Michelin Keys extension into Brazil and Argentina (Source: Latin America's 50 Best Restaurants, 2026).
